dambram, do you have any issues with the 32s rubbing with the Rustys 4"? I ordered a 4" from Rustys last week, just waiting for it to ship. I would like to run 32s or 33s but I know I will have to do some trimming with 33s. I also know some brands of tires are actually taller than other brands of the "same size".

32x11.5s fit a 4" lift well if you use a 15x8 wheel. I have run them on 3 different 4" lifts with no rub including Rustys brand pictured below.
